What is a Non-Custodial Mixing Protocol?

A non-custodial mixing protocol is a decentralized system designed to obscure the trail of cryptocurrency transactions by blending a user’s coins with those of others. This process, often referred to as "coin mixing" or "tumbling," ensures that the origin of funds cannot be traced back to the original sender. Unlike custodial services, which require users to deposit funds into a third-party wallet, non-custodial protocols eliminate the need for intermediaries. Instead, the mixing occurs through smart contracts or decentralized networks, where users maintain control of their private keys at all times.

Definition and Core Principles

The core principle of a non-custodial mixing protocol is decentralization. By removing custodians, these protocols reduce the risk of theft, hacking, or regulatory interference. Users initiate the mixing process by sending their funds to a designated address, which is then combined with other users’ coins through a complex algorithm. The result is a set of "clean" coins that are indistinguishable from the original transaction. This method is particularly effective for Bitcoin and other privacy-focused cryptocurrencies, where transparency is a major concern.

How It Differs from Custodial Methods

Custodial mixing services, such as those offered by centralized exchanges or dedicated mixing platforms, require users to trust a third party with their funds. This introduces vulnerabilities, as custodians could potentially misuse or lose the assets. In contrast, a non-custodial mixing protocol operates on a trustless model. Users interact directly with the protocol’s smart contracts or decentralized nodes, ensuring that no single entity has control over the funds. This not only enhances security but also aligns with the principles of blockchain technology, which emphasizes transparency and user autonomy.

Smart Contracts and Automation

Smart contracts play a pivotal role in non-custodial mixing protocols. These self-executing agreements are programmed to handle the mixing process automatically, eliminating the need for manual oversight. When a user initiates a transaction, the smart contract receives the funds and distributes them according to predefined rules. For example, the contract might split the coins into multiple smaller amounts and send them to different addresses, making it nearly impossible to trace the original source. This automation not only speeds up the process but also reduces the risk of human error or manipulation.

Decentralized Network Architecture

The decentralized nature of non-custodial mixing protocols is another critical factor in their security. Instead of relying on a central server, these protocols distribute the mixing process across a network of nodes. Each node contributes to the mixing by processing transactions and ensuring that the output is randomized. This distributed approach makes it extremely difficult for attackers to compromise the system, as there is no single point of failure. Additionally, the use of blockchain technology ensures that all transactions are recorded immutably, further enhancing transparency and accountability.

Technical Complexity

The technical nature of non-custodial mixing protocols can be a barrier for some users. Unlike custodial services, which often provide user-friendly interfaces, non-custodial protocols may require a deeper understanding of blockchain technology and cryptographic principles. This complexity can deter users who are not technically inclined, limiting the protocol’s accessibility. However, as the technology matures, developers are working on simplifying the user experience through intuitive interfaces and automated tools, making it easier for a broader audience to benefit from non-custodial mixing.

Regulatory Scrutiny

Regulatory concerns also pose a challenge for non-custodial mixing protocols. Governments and financial authorities are increasingly scrutinizing cryptocurrency transactions, particularly those involving privacy-focused methods. While non-custodial mixing is designed to enhance privacy, it can also be perceived as a tool for illicit activities. This has led to calls for stricter regulations, which could impact the legality or accessibility of these protocols in certain jurisdictions. To navigate this landscape, developers and users must stay informed about evolving regulations and ensure compliance with local laws.
